Peanut Butter and Jelly Crepes

Since there is no reason why you can't make extra crepes and then refrigerate the pancakes until you need to fill them, crepes can also be a great lunch box idea. These Peanut Butter and Jelly Crepes are proof of that.

Prep Time
10 mins
Cook Time
10 mins
Total Time
15 mins
Servings: 4
Calories: 186 kcal
Course: Breakfast , Lunch
Cuisine: American

Ingredients

  • 1 recipe Greek yogurt
  • peanut butter, room temperature
  • Fruit preserves

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. Make crepes per recipe directions and place on a plate
  2. Spread one heaping tablespoon of peanut butter on one crepe and then spread with 1 heaping tablespoon of preserves.
  3. Repeat with remaining crepes.
  4. Roll crepe into a log and slice to serve.
